Seminars in the field of population and development are held twice a year in two different cities in Japan in an effort to increase understanding and support of population issues among the general public. APDA invites distinguished speakers and sets themes that relate to Japanese public interest (such as dwindling birth rate, aging population, environment, HIV/AIDS, gender, Reproductive Health) on a more global perspective.
